Side-by-Side Comparison
| Feature | stetig | Stettin |
|---|---|---|
| Definition | kontinuierlich, zusammenhängend, ohne Unterbrechung | deutsche Bezeichnung der Stadt Szczecin, Polen |

Spelling & Dictionary Insight
These two trip readers on the page rather than in the ear: stetig is [ˈʃteːtɪç] while Stettin is [ʃtɛˈtiːn]. Spoken aloud the problem disappears. In writing it persists, because they differ by 1 letter(s) in length, and the parts of speech differ too (adjective vs name), which is usually the fastest check.
